Abstract

A pump, in particular for a vehicle brake system, includes a pump piston which is guided displaceably in a pump cylinder. The pump cylinder is produced by deep drawing.

Claims

exact text as granted — not AI-modified
1 . A pump, comprising:
 a pump cylinder; and   a pump piston guided displaceably in the pump cylinder,   wherein the pump cylinder is produced by deep drawing.   
     
     
         2 . The pump as claimed in  claim 1 , wherein the pump cylinder is received in a pump housing in such a way that it is supported in a planar manner against the pump housing via its outer lateral surface. 
     
     
         3 . The pump as claimed in  claim 1 , wherein the pump cylinder is beaker-shaped and has an annular wall and a base area. 
     
     
         4 . The pump as claimed in  claim 3 , wherein the base area defines a valve opening configured to be selectively closed by a valve body. 
     
     
         5 . The pump as claimed in  claim 3 , wherein the annular wall defines at least one inlet opening to the pump piston. 
     
     
         6 . The pump as claimed in  claim 3 , wherein the annular wall defines a multiplicity of inlet openings that form a filter screen on the annular wall. 
     
     
         7 . The pump as claimed in  claim 4 , wherein the valve opening is produced by punching. 
     
     
         8 . The pump as claimed in  claim 3 , wherein an annular disk is formed at the end of the annular wall arranged opposite the base area. 
     
     
         9 . The pump as claimed in  claim 3 , wherein an annular step is formed at the end of the annular wall arranged opposite the base area. 
     
     
         10 . A vehicle brake system, comprising:
 a pump including:
 a pump cylinder; and 
 a pump piston guided displaceably in the pump cylinder, 
 wherein the pump cylinder is produced by deep drawing. 
   
     
     
         11 . A method for producing a pump, comprising:
 forming at least one opening in a sheet metal;   deep drawing the sheet metal to form a pump cylinder, the sheet metal deep drawn in such a way that one or more of a valve opening, an inlet opening, and an outlet opening of the pump cylinder are formed by the opening; and   assembling a pump piston in the pump cylinder.   
     
     
         12 . The pump as claimed in  claim 1 , wherein the pump is for a vehicle brake system. 
     
     
         13 . The pump as claimed in  claim 7 , wherein the valve opening is produced by punching before the pump cylinder has been produced by deep drawing. 
     
     
         14 . The pump as claimed in  claim 5 , wherein the at least one inlet opening is produced by punching. 
     
     
         15 . The pump as claimed in  claim 14 , wherein the at least one inlet opening is produced by punching before the pump cylinder has been produced by deep drawing. 
     
     
         16 . The pump as claimed in  claim 6 , wherein the multiplicity of inlet openings are produced by punching. 
     
     
         17 . The pump as claimed in  claim 16 , wherein the multiplicity of inlet openings are produced by punching before the pump cylinder has been produced by deep drawing. 
     
     
         18 . The pump as claimed in  claim 9 , further comprising a ring seal arranged between the pump piston and the annular step of the pump cylinder.
